The 2018 Dodge Ram 1500 offers dozens of cat-back exhaust options, ranging from mild to wild. Understanding the differences is essential to achieving your desired sound profile. Axle-back systems replace only the muffler and tailpipe, offering a moderate sound increase with the simplest installation. Cat-back systems replace everything from the catalytic converter rearward, including the intermediate pipe, muffler, and tailpipe, providing more significant sound and performance gains. Materials matter significantly: 409 stainless steel offers good corrosion resistance at a lower price point, while 304 stainless steel provides superior rust protection and a longer lifespan, especially in northern climates where road salt is prevalent. Muffler design determines the sound character. A chambered muffler (like Flowmaster's Super 44 or Super 10) produces the classic deep, aggressive "muscle car" tone with pronounced idle rumble. A straight-through design (like Magnaflow or Borla) offers a smoother, more refined sound that remains civilized during highway cruising but roars under heavy acceleration. For most Ram owners, a mild to moderate system strikes the perfect balance—loud enough to announce the Hemi's presence but quiet enough for daily driving and towing without drone at constant speeds.
